**Action item (security):** The Liftwise dispatch simulator accepted unsigned scenario files during the incident, letting a malformed payload crash the scheduler. Add signature verification to the scenario loader and reject unsigned input in all environments, not just production. Owner: platform team, due next sprint. Verification steps and the signing key rotation procedure are documented on the internal page below.

runbook for badug-kadup: https://confluence.zemvarlabs.internal/projects/browse/display/projects/bd1b

Subject: Quickstore 4.2 — bloom filter now fronts the KV layer

Plugin authors: starting with this release, Quickstore places a bloom filter ahead of the key-value store. Negative lookups return faster; false positives fall through safely. No API changes are required on your side. Verify your plugin against the staging build referenced below.

session token of fahif-tadup = htk3_9c7

TURN-208: Gatevale turnstile counters at the Merrow Field pilot double-count when a rotation reverses mid-cycle. Attendance totals drift roughly 2% high per event. The debounce window fix is implemented, reviewed by Ilsa, and soak-tested across two simulated match days without drift. Ready for your cut; the candidate build is identified below.

trace token, tagag-tafog: htk6_5ed18c